Вопрос по статичным сайтам

ВТ
На сайте с 20.02.2012
Offline
110
523

Привет, ребята !

У нас есть сайт - интернет - магазин с кучей товарных позиций ( порядка 800 ).

Сайт статичный, на html. Хотел спросить - можно ли цены на сайте сделать некоей переменной, задаваемой где - нибудь с тем, чтобы после каждого изменения курса рубля к доллару не менять цены вручную. Может кто подскажет как поступить ?

bon_eur
На сайте с 09.06.2012
Offline
40
#1
Вот_так:
Привет, ребята !
У нас есть сайт - интернет - магазин с кучей товарных позиций ( порядка 800 ).
Сайт статичный, на html. Хотел спросить - можно ли цены на сайте сделать некоей переменной, задаваемой где - нибудь с тем, чтобы после каждого изменения курса рубля к доллару не менять цены вручную. Может кто подскажет как поступить ?

Думаю, будет несложно научиться азам php, и вставить в статичные страницы крошечный кусок кода. Хостинг поддерживает php?

Если есть зависимость цен только лишь от курса доллара, то самое простое решение - хранить этот курс в отдельном файле, который подключать на каждой страничке.

ВТ
На сайте с 20.02.2012
Offline
110
#2

да, хостинг поддерживает php

если можно - чуть подробнее

bon_eur
На сайте с 09.06.2012
Offline
40
#3

1. Надо включить обработку php для html-файлов. Прописываем в .htaccess (если файла в корне сайта нет - создать) строчку:

AddType application/x-httpd-php .php .html

2. Создаем файл usd2rur.php такого содержания:

<?php


function usd2rur($price)
{
echo $price * 32.5;
}

?>

3. В каждом статичном html-файле с ценами ОДИН раз подгружаем файл usd2rur.php с помощью кода:

<?php


require 'usd2rur.php';

?>

4. В html-файлах, например, для товара ценой $123 пишем код для вывода рублевой цены:

<?php usd2rur(123)?>

Надеюсь, что помог.

ВТ
На сайте с 20.02.2012
Offline
110
#4

еще как помогли, спасибо

еще вопрос - а можно значение самого курса подгружать из базы цб, чтобы все цены пересчитывались автоматом ?

---------- Добавлено 10.06.2012 в 17:47 ----------

все таки новичку оч трудно сразу все сделать точно, видимо где - то промахнулся - выводит пустые значения

в п3 не понял в какое место прописать код

в акцесс строку прописал

файл сделал

в п3 - не ясно в какое место в html файле прописать код

сделал

The WishMaster
На сайте с 29.09.2005
Offline
2542
#5

Все же стоит нанять программиста.

Пешу текста дешыго! Тематики - туризм, СЕО, творчество, кулинария, шизотерика :)
bon_eur
На сайте с 09.06.2012
Offline
40
#6
Вот_так:
еще вопрос - а можно значение самого курса подгружать из базы цб, чтобы все цены пересчитывались автоматом ?

Можно, но надо понимать, что мы начинаем зависеть от другого сайта. Изменится там формат выдачи - и скрипт не сможет считать курс, или неправильно его считает.

Ну и конечно лучше это делать не в реальном времени, а запрашивать курс раз в день, сохраняя его локально.

Вот_так:
все таки новичку оч трудно сразу все сделать точно, видимо где - то промахнулся - выводит пустые значения

Скорее всего, какая-то мелкая проблема - надо подробнее посмотреть. К сожалению, не могу вам ответить на ЛС - прав нет. Написал в аську, так как это уже не всем будет интересно.

ВТ
На сайте с 20.02.2012
Offline
110
#7

спасибо огромное bon_eur , все работает как надо, просто благодарен

bon_eur
На сайте с 09.06.2012
Offline
40
#8
Вот_так:
спасибо огромное bon_eur , все работает как надо, просто благодарен

К сожалению, получилось не так быстро, как хотелось бы... Приятно было познакомиться!

Авторизуйтесь или зарегистрируйтесь, чтобы оставить комментарий